Besides GC, Has Ruby 2.3 Helped Rails Performance?

You may have read recently about how Rails performance has changed with recent Ruby versions. In that post, I concluded that newer Ruby is using a bit more memory, and has improved performance for the slowest requests by a lot. But that benchmark is pretty dependent on garbage collection (aka GC,) at least for the worst requests. You can read the original post for all the numbers of how things changed, and it's pretty clear that GC figures in significantly.What if we measure Rails performance without garbage collection? What does it look like then?.
